In the tehcnical reference manual of the TMS320F28377D there is a duty cycle range limitation described in chapter 15.2.4.3 on page 2012. On this page it states the following:
"When using DBREDHR or DBFEDHR, DBRED and/or DBFED (the register corresponding to the edge with hi-resolution displacement) must be greater than or equal to 3."
But on page 2018 in chapter 15.2.5 it states the following:
"Just like the duty cycle restrictions when using HRPWM, the DBRED and DBFED values must be greater than 3 to use hi-res deadband."
Which one of the two statements is the right one? Because for my application I need a very small deadband, and now I don't know if I need to set it to 3 or 4.
